exhaust plans are this, obviously i got shorty headers(had to go this route with the heads b/c long tubes get in the way of the spark plugs for some reason), 2.5" true duals possibly with magnaflow high flow cats(for inspection purposes and they are basically straight thru), and the mufflers, then either dump them after the mufflers or run it back with 45's and 3" echo tips at the bed corners.

Like said above, the gasser needs a little restriction. I almost wish it was a 460. i know where there is a 429, but i think i would do very bad things if i put a 429 in this truck. the 429 i'm talking about is in a 74 ford F350 dually work truck w/ a 4 speed and when it ran and you floored it you'd end up on the side of the road with a driveshaft twisted in 2 pieces.
